JONES v. CLARK

No. 09-3574.

630 F.3d 677 (2011)

Christina JONES, Plaintiff-Appellee, v. Craig CLARK and Donn Kaminski, Defendants-Appellants.

United States Court of Appeals, Seventh Circuit.

Decided January 14, 2011.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Edward M. Fox (argued), Fox & Associates, Chicago, IL, for Plaintiff-Appellee.

William W. Kurnik (argued), Knight, Hoppe, Kurnik & Knight, Rosemont, IL, for Defendants-Appellants.

Before WOOD, EVANS, and SYKES, Circuit Judges.


WOOD, Circuit Judge.

Christina Jones is an employee of Commonwealth Edison ("ComEd"), which is the major electricity provider in the Chicago area. One day, while working in her job as a meter reader in Braidwood, Illinois, she was stopped and then arrested by Officers Craig Clark and Donn Kaminski.
